Types of Fireplace Tabletops

The market offers a diverse range of fireplace tabletops catering to various styles and preferences. Understanding the different types is crucial for making an informed decision:

1. Electric Fireplace Tabletops:

  • Pros: These are the most popular choice due to their ease of use, safety, and versatility. They offer realistic flame effects without the need for venting or fuel. Many models offer adjustable heat settings and remote control functionality.   • Cons: They can be slightly more expensive than biofuel options and require an electrical outlet.

2. Biofuel Fireplace Tabletops:

  • Pros: Biofuel fireplaces offer a real flame experience with a cleaner burn than traditional wood-burning fireplaces. They are relatively easy to install and don't require a chimney.   • Cons: They require the purchase and regular replenishment of biofuel, and proper ventilation is essential to prevent the buildup of carbon dioxide. Always ensure adequate ventilation when using a biofuel fireplace.

3. Gel Fuel Fireplace Tabletops:

  • Cons: Gel fuel can be relatively expensive, and the flame is generally smaller and less intense than bioethanol or electric options. Always follow manufacturer safety guidelines for gel fuel fireplaces.

Choosing the Right Fireplace Tabletop: Key Considerations

Selecting the perfect fireplace tabletop involves careful consideration of several factors:

  • Heat Output: If you primarily want the heating functionality, consider the heat output (measured in BTUs) and choose a model that suits the size of your room.
  • Safety Features: Look for safety features such as overheat protection, automatic shutoff, and sturdy construction. This is especially important for models with real flames.
  • Maintenance: Consider the ongoing maintenance required for different types. Electric fireplaces are generally low-maintenance, while biofuel fireplaces require regular refueling and cleaning.
  • Budget: Fireplace tabletops range in price depending on the type, features, and brand. Set a budget before you start shopping.

Safety Precautions for Fireplace Tabletops

Regardless of the type you choose, always prioritize safety:

  • Keep away from flammable materials: Never place the fireplace near curtains, furniture, or other flammable items.
  • Proper ventilation: Ensure adequate ventilation, especially for biofuel and gel fuel fireplaces.
  • Supervision: Never leave a burning fireplace unattended.
  • Keep out of reach of children and pets: Place the fireplace in a location inaccessible to children and pets.
  • Follow manufacturer instructions: Carefully read and follow all manufacturer instructions before using your fireplace tabletop.
